Home   Package List   Routine Alphabetical List   Global Alphabetical List   FileMan Files List   FileMan Sub-Files List   Package Component Lists   Package-Namespace Mapping  
Info |  Source |  Call Graph |  Entry Points |  External References |  Interaction Calls |  FileMan Files Accessed Via FileMan Db Call |  Global Variables Directly Accessed |  Label References |  Local Variables |  All
Print Page as PDF
Routine: BCHDCOMM

Package: IHS RPMS CHR System

Routine: BCHDCOMM


Information

BCHDCOMM ; IHS/CMI/LAB - COMMUNITY DOWNLOAD ROUTINE ;

Source Information

Source file <BCHDCOMM.m>

Call Graph

Call Graph Total: 4

Package Total Call Graph
VA Fileman 2 ^DIC  ^DIR  
IHS VA Utilities 1 ^XBGSAVE  
Kernel 1 $$FMADD^XLFDT  

Entry Points

Name Comments DBIA/ICR reference
XIT ;
WRITEF ;EP - write out flat file
COMM ;get communities and set in ^XTMP
EP ;
AREA ;select desired area

External References

Name Field # of Occurrence
^DIC AREA+2
^DIR WRITEF+4
^XBGSAVE WRITEF+9
$$FMADD^XLFDT EP+7

Interaction Calls

Name Line Occurrences
Function Call: WRITE
  • Prompt: !!,"This utility routine is used to download, by Area, all communities in the",!,"COMMUNITY file to the remote computer."
  • Line Location: EP+2
Function Call: WRITE
  • Prompt: !!,"You will be asked to enter your Area. A unix file will be created",!,"called communit.imp. It must be then put in the C:\CHR directory on the ",!,"remote and uploaded into that machine.",!!
  • Line Location: EP+3
Function Call: WRITE
  • Prompt: !!,"NO COMMUNITIES SELECTED."
  • Line Location: WRITEF+1
Function Call: WRITE
  • Prompt: !,^XTMP("BCH COMMUNITIES",$J,X)
  • Line Location: WRITEF+2
Function Call: WRITE
  • Prompt: !
  • Line Location: WRITEF+3
Function Call: WRITE
  • Prompt: !!,"BYE",!
  • Line Location: WRITEF+5
Routine Call
  • DIC
  • Line Location:
    • AREA+2
Routine Call
  • DIR
  • Line Location:
    • WRITEF+4

FileMan Files Accessed Via FileMan Db Call

FileNo Call Tags
^AUTTAREA - [#9999999.21] Classic Fileman Calls

Global Variables Directly Accessed

Name Line Occurrences  (* Changed,  ! Killed)
^AUTTCOM - [#9999999.05] COMM+1, COMM+2, COMM+4
^XTMP("BCH COMMUNITIES" EP+6!, EP+7*, AREA+3, COMM+4*, WRITEF+1, WRITEF+2, XIT+1!

Label References

Name Line Occurrences
AREA EP+8
COMM EP+10
WRITEF EP+11
XIT EP+12, WRITEF+1, WRITEF+5

Local Variables

Legend:

>> Not killed explicitly
* Changed
! Killed
~ Newed

Name Field # of Occurrence
>> BCHAREA AREA+4*, COMM+2
>> BCHIEN COMM+1*, COMM+2, COMM+4
BCHQ EP+9, AREA+1*, AREA+3*, XIT+2!
C EP+5*, COMM+3*, COMM+4, WRITEF+2, XIT+2!
DA WRITEF+4!
>> DIC AREA+2*
>> DIC(0 AREA+2*
DIR WRITEF+4!
DIR("A" WRITEF+4*
DIR("B" WRITEF+4*
DIR(0 WRITEF+4*
>> DIRUT WRITEF+5
DT EP+7
IOF EP+1
U EP+7, COMM+2, COMM+4
X WRITEF+2*, XIT+2!
>> XBE WRITEF+8*
>> XBF WRITEF+8*
>> XBFLT WRITEF+8*
>> XBFN WRITEF+7*
>> XBGL WRITEF+6*
>> XBMED WRITEF+7*
>> XBQ WRITEF+8*
>> XBTLE WRITEF+7*
>> Y AREA+3, AREA+4, WRITEF+5
Info |  Source |  Call Graph |  Entry Points |  External References |  Interaction Calls |  FileMan Files Accessed Via FileMan Db Call |  Global Variables Directly Accessed |  Label References |  Local Variables |  All